It seems they were even pricing themselves out of the iPad market, but changed their minds:
--- Quote ---Vodafone has issued its official iPad 3G data tariffs - making them more attractive than the figures published by Apple this morning.
Visitors to the Apple website were told Vodafone was offering customers only 250MB of data per month for £10, rising to £25 for 5GB. That left Vodafone looking remarkably more expensive than its rivals, with Orange offering 3GB of data for £15 per month, and O2 allowing customers to pay £10 or £15 for a monthly data cap of 1GB or 3GB respectively.
Vodafone this morning disowned the Apple figures. This afternoon, it set the prices at £10 for 1GB and £25 for 5GB, bringing its prices in tandem with O2 and Orange.
When challenged on whether Vodafone had changed its prices in reaction to its rivals, a company spokesman told PC Pro: "we didn't announce anything until this afternoon."
--- End quote ---
